Abstract

Systems and methods for smart alarms are provided. A computer-implemented method includes: receiving, by a computing device, an input including a set alarm time; determining, by the computing device, a battery drain condition of the computing device; and based on the determining the battery drain condition, performing a step including one of: sounding the alarm prior to the set alarm time based on determining that a user-defined condition is met at a time of the battery drain condition; displaying a message on the computing device indicating the battery drain condition; and providing an alternate alert based on a detected sleep stage of a user corresponding to a predefined acceptable sleep stage.

Claims (23)

1. A computer-implemented method comprising:

receiving, by a computing device, preference data from a user device;

receiving, by the computing device, a set alarm time of the user device;

determining, by the computing device, an alert from the user device indicates that a battery drain condition of the user device will result in a failed alarm at the set alarm time at the user device;

based on the receiving the alert, determining a ranked list of members of a backup alarm group specified in the preference data, wherein each member of the members is ranked based on a proximity of each member of the members to the user device and an alertness state of each member of the members; and

sending a message to the highest ranked member in the ranked list, wherein the message instructs the highest ranked member to provide an alternate alert to a user associated with the user device.

2. The method of claim 1 , wherein:

the computing device comprises a server; and

the user device comprises one of a smartphone, a smart watch, a tablet computer, and a laptop computer.

3. The method of claim 1 , wherein the battery drain condition of the user device is based on at least one of:

a battery charge level of the user device being less than or equal to a predefined level; and

the battery charge level of the user device being insufficient to maintain the user device in a powered on state until the set alarm time.

4. The method of claim 1 , wherein the computing device includes software provided as a service in a cloud environment.

5. The method of claim 1 , further comprising deploying a system for providing a backup alarm, comprising providing a computer infrastructure operable to perform the steps of claim 1 .

6. The method of claim 1 , wherein a service provider at least one of creates, maintains, deploys and supports the computing device.

7. The method of claim 1 , wherein steps of claim 1 are provided by a service provider on a subscription, advertising, and/or fee basis.
